Floor drain cleaning


clogged floor drain repairsMany homes have flooring drains in their basements, utility room, garages and outdoor patios to keep excess water from flooding and causing damage. Due to the fact that basements are the bottom-most parts of houses, floor drains are particularly common in them, given that rain and sewage system water can so quickly circulation downward and flood basements. Like drains you might find in your sink or tub, flooring drains are geared up with traps below. These traps must be kept loaded with water to avoid sewer gases and odors from escaping into the space.

The most common issue with flooring drains is just that they or the traps can end up being obstructed with dirt and debris. Sump pump maintenance


Sump pumps are another typical draining system discovered in basements. They keep ground water from flooding the house by diverting it into nearby storm drains, wells or ponds. If you have a sump pump that isn't working properly, it might trigger flooding and damage, especially after heavy rainfall. Basement plumbing tips


Appropriately preserving your basement floor drain and sump pump will make them less likely to need repair. Here are a number of upkeep tips:

Keep your trap seal full: Because your basement flooring drain doesn't get a great deal of usage, it's important to by hand keep the trap seal underneath it filled with water. If the trap seal isn't really complete, it could allow sewer gases to back up into your basement. So what should you do? Simply put a pail of water down the drain every so often.
Evaluate your sump pump frequently: You can utilize the same method to evaluate your sump pump prior to the rainy season begins. Pour a bucket of water into the sump pit - the system should turn on, pump the water away and turn off.
